Output 979120770b219576c993f44d3fe3aebaaabd058411946a12588a35b290e6db1d:0

value
19828943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67ea52e6dc640a20627cfbfb427544b3c9c0bea9 OP_EQUAL
address
MHNcYJ1zXRDcnZdTTqg9R73aVWyUoh2G21
transaction
979120770b219576c993f44d3fe3aebaaabd058411946a12588a35b290e6db1d
spent
true